    Well, finally there is a first preview of PS v1.9 available for Pocket PC (aka Windows Mobile Classic/Professional aka "devices with touchscreens"). Some changes:

    Browsing tab:
    - new "Recent tracks" page
    - new "Recommendations" page
    - enhanced "Events" page displaying playing artists and a list of your friends attending
    - enhanced "Friends" page displaying the last track played by each friend
    - fixed missing weekly charts on "Charts" page
    - fixed bug preventing adding of event to Outlook calendar if event takes place in March
    - all parts of the browsing tab now use the 2.0 webservices of last.fm; the migration might have introduced some bugs in previously working parts of the application, thus please report any issue (e.g. I'm aware of the tasteometer being sometimes inaccurate).

    Other parts of the app:
    - possibility to temporarily disable scrobbling (checkbox on status tab has to be enabled in options first)
    - you can now bulk submit tracks to last.fm every n-scrobbled tracks to preserve battery power
    - "on tour" banner during radio playback in case artist is on tour (tapping it brings you to the event page of the browsing tab)
    - excluded msxml3.dll from setup, thus fixing XML error messages
    - ability to add a track to an existing/a new playlist
    - fixed some display issues on WVGA devices (HTC HD2 etc.)
    - several smaller bug fixes I forgot about

    Which version of TouchFlo (i.e. which device/custom or OEM ROM) are you using? As far as I know, Pocket Scrobbler works with all versions of the HTC Audiomanager/TouchFlo. In fact I've been using v1.8 on my HTC HD2 since December without a problem.

    However, keep in mind that in order to get TouchFlo compatibility, you first have to change the media player interface in Menu > Media player interfaces to "HTC Audio Manager interface". After that, restart both the user interface and the background service using Menu > Close window and service.

    Known issue if Opera is associated with local *.HTM files. In Menu > Advanced > Misc, make sure that "Check HTML file association" is checked, then restart the application. On the next startup, a message box will ask you to associate *.HTM files with Internet Explorer. Confirm this and Opera shouldn't be launched anymore. Note that this will not change your default browser; Opera can be used as before.
